设计模式学习--Factory Method Pattern(工厂方法模式)
摘要: 工厂方法模式又称工厂模式,也叫虚拟构造器模式或多态工厂模式,属于类的创建型模式。在工厂方法模式中,父类负责定义创建对象的公共接口,而子类则负责生成具体的对象,这样做的目的是将类的实例化操作延迟到子类中完成,即由子类来决定究竟应该实例化哪一个类。
阅读全文
posted @
2008-10-07 13:46 zhanghaibin 阅读(416) |
评论 (1) 编辑
设计模式学习--Simple Factory Pattern(简单工厂模式)
摘要: 专门定义一个类来负责创建其他类的实例,被创建的实例通常都具有共同的父类。简单工厂模式又称为静态工厂方法模式,属于类的创建型模式,通常它根据自变量的不同返回不同的类的实例。
阅读全文
posted @
2008-10-06 13:49 zhanghaibin 阅读(334) |
评论 (0) 编辑